Responsibilities:
Make referrals to members of the extended care team and/or notify provider of post discharge needs or discrepancies in plans of care. Mentors, orients and provides ongoing training to current and new staff members. Obtain lab/x-ray reports, hospital notes, referral information, etc. Verify insurance coverage and patient demographics. Prepare and managing charts to ensure information completed and filed appropriately. Other front office responsibilities, as required. Prepare patient rooms, set up instruments and equipment according to department protocol. Clean exam/procedure rooms, instruments and equipment between patient visits to maintain infection control. Accompany patients to exam/procedure room. Assist patients as needed with walking, transfers, dressing, collecting specimens, preparing for exam, etc. Collect patient information/history; taking vitals, performing screenings per provider guidelines. Answering calls and providing pertinent information including patient education as directed. Perform phlebotomy, EKG's, and level one labs. Assist physicians with procedures. Document patient information into the medical record. Answering calls and providing pertinent information including patient education as directed. Perform clinic procedures according to policy and procedure. Assist physicians with procedures. Document patient information into the medical record. Under the direction and supervision of a physician, administer injectable medication and vaccines when appropriate.
